I've recently been working with trying to build the kernel for the OMAP-L138 to run on the LCDK dev board.
There doesn't seem to be an issue with building the kernel, doing # make linux in the Linux SDK folder works fine.
The zImage is generated and I was able to figure out how to use mkimage to modify the zImage so U Boot can load the kernel, which is done.
However, I don't think that the config file for the hardware/peripherals being used to generate the Linux kernel is the correct one.
The SD card which shipped with the dev kit has kernel v3.3 on it and this works fine.
The machine in the Linux output during boot is the following:
Machine: AM18x/OMAP-L138 lcdk board
When I build the kernel on my machine it is version 4.19.94 and the machine is different:
Machine: AM18x/OMAP-L138 Hawkboard
When the version 4.19.94 kernel boots it gets stuck after interacting with the SD card (below is the output at boot time)
